7 Keto-Friendly Drink Options
1. Americano
This is just espresso diluted with water, making it a simple, bold coffee choice. It has no added flavors unless you customize.

How to order: Ask for a hot or iced Americano. Add a sugar-free syrup like vanilla if you want to taste without carbs.
Net carbs: About 2g for a small, 3g for a large. Calories: Around 10-15.
Sizes: Small 16 oz = ~2g carbs | Medium 24 oz = ~3g | Large 32 oz = ~4g.
Why it’s keto: No milk or sugar by default; sugar-free syrups keep carbs minimal.
2. Cold Brew
Smooth and less acidic than regular coffee, cold brew steeps longer for a concentrated flavor. It’s naturally low in carbs.

How to order: Get it iced or toasted (hot). Skip any milk, or add a splash of heavy cream for creaminess.
Net carbs: 2g small, up to 4g large. Calories: Roughly 15-20.
Sizes: Small = ~2g carbs | Medium = ~3g | Large = ~4g.
Why it’s keto: Black cold brew is carb-free; only small additions like cream or sugar-free syrup impact macros.
3. Nitro-Infused Cold Brew
Similar to regular cold brew but with nitrogen for a creamy texture, like a draft beer pour. No dairy needed for that foam.

How to order: Request nitro cold brew, iced or hot. Keep it plain or add sugar-free hazelnut syrup.
Net carbs: Estimated at 2g in any size. Calories: About 15.
Sizes: Typically served in Small 16 oz or Medium 24 oz only; both ~2g carbs.
Why it’s keto: Naturally rich and creamy without milk, so no hidden carbs.
4. Zero Sugar Rebel
Dutch Bros’ energy drink line, the zero-sugar version, gives a boost without the carbs from regular ones. Flavors include strawberry or peach.

How to order: Say “zero sugar Rebel” and pick iced or blended. Blended might add 1g of carbs from the process.
Net carbs: 1-3g depending on size. Calories: 10-20.
Sizes: Small = 1–2g | Medium = 2–3g | Large = up to 4g.
Why it’s keto: Made with sucralose, not sugar; carb counts stay very low across sizes.
5. Green Tea
A light, antioxidant-rich option with lemongrass and citrus notes. It’s caffeine-moderate and refreshing.

How to order: Hot or iced green tea, plain. If you like, infuse with sugar-free raspberry for variety.
Net carbs: 0g. Calories: 0-5.
Sizes: Any size (Small–Large) = 0g carbs, 0–5 calories.
Why it’s keto: Unsweetened tea has no carbs, making it the lowest-carb Dutch Bros drink.
6. Earl Grey Tea
Bold black tea with bergamot for a citrusy twist. Great if you want something warm and aromatic without coffee.

How to order: Order hot or iced Earl Grey. No additions needed, but sugar-free vanilla pairs nicely.
Net carbs: 0g. Calories: 5.
Sizes: Any size (Small–Large) = 0g carbs, 5 calories.
Why it’s keto: Pure tea with no sugars or additives; sugar-free syrups keep it keto-safe.
7. Sugar-Free Almond Milk Kicker
A customized latte with Irish cream flavor, made keto by using sugar-free syrup and almond milk. It’s like a milder mocha.

How to order: Ask for a Kicker with sugar-free Irish cream syrup and unsweetened almond milk. Hot, iced, or blended.
Net carbs: Around 3g for small. Calories: 50-70.
Sizes: Small = ~3g carbs | Medium = ~4g | Large = ~5g.
Why it’s keto: Using almond milk and sugar-free syrup cuts carbs significantly compared to the regular version.
What Makes a Drink Keto-Friendly at Dutch Bros?
Keto focuses on minimizing carbs to stay in ketosis, so look for drinks without added sugars. Plain espresso, teas, and certain energy drinks work well.
Swap regular syrups for sugar-free versions, which Dutch Bros offers in flavors like vanilla, caramel, chocolate, and strawberry.
Use unsweetened almond milk or heavy cream instead of dairy milk to cut carbs further. Avoid whipped cream or sugary toppings.
Portion size matters too; smaller drinks usually have fewer carbs. Check full sugar free drinks menu with prices.

Dutch Bros Sizes & Keto Impact
Dutch Bros serves drinks in three main cup sizes. Portion size directly affects carb counts, even with sugar-free options. A larger cup means more base liquid and more pumps of syrup, which can add 1–2g net carbs per size jump.
- Stick with Small (16 oz) if you want the lowest carb count.
- Medium (24 oz) drinks usually add +1g net carb.
- Large (32 oz) can bump totals by +2–3g net carbs, depending on milk and syrup.
- Tea-based drinks are safe at any size since they contain 0g net carbs.

FAQs
What is the lowest carb drink at Dutch Bros?
Unsweetened green tea and Earl Grey tea are the lowest carb options with around 0g net carbs.
Does Dutch Bros have sugar-free syrups?
Yes. Dutch Bros offers sugar-free vanilla, caramel, hazelnut, Irish cream, coconut, raspberry, peach, and more.
Can you order keto coffee at Dutch Bros?
Yes. Americanos, cold brews, and sugar-free iced coffees are popular keto-friendly choices.
Are Dutch Bros Rebels keto-friendly?
Only the Zero Sugar Rebel versions are considered keto-friendly. Regular Rebels contain high sugar.
What milk is best for keto at Dutch Bros?
Unsweetened almond milk and heavy cream are the best low-carb options.
Do blended Dutch Bros drinks have carbs?
Yes. Most blended drinks use a sugary base that can add 15–30g carbs.
